Pontiac Ventura II/Pontiac Ventura. 1971–4 (prod. 7,058 GTO sold for 1974 only). 2-, 3- and 4-door sedan. F/R, 250 in³ (I6 OHV), 307, 350 in³ (V8 OHV). Pontiac’s version of Chevrolet Chevy II Nova, called Ventura II for its first year, Ventura thereafter. Unrelated to the larger car that bore the name previously. Pontiac versions usually plusher than Chevrolet’s. Three-door added 1973, and GTO package shifted to Ventura for 1974, making it far lighter than the Colonnade model from the previous year. Sprint typically denoted the performance model. Average in most respects, but 1973 V8s less than reliable.


Manufacturing location: Van Nuys, California, USA
